Liza M. Rubenstein is a scholar working on Clinical Psychology, Experimental and Cognitive Psychology and Cognitive Neuroscience. According to data from OpenAlex, Liza M. Rubenstein has authored 10 papers receiving a total of 353 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 9 papers in Clinical Psychology, 4 papers in Experimental and Cognitive Psychology and 2 papers in Cognitive Neuroscience. Recurrent topics in Liza M. Rubenstein’s work include Obsessive-Compulsive Spectrum Disorders (4 papers), Anxiety, Depression, Psychometrics, Treatment, Cognitive Processes (4 papers) and Child and Adolescent Psychosocial and Emotional Development (4 papers). Liza M. Rubenstein is often cited by papers focused on Obsessive-Compulsive Spectrum Disorders (4 papers), Anxiety, Depression, Psychometrics, Treatment, Cognitive Processes (4 papers) and Child and Adolescent Psychosocial and Emotional Development (4 papers). Liza M. Rubenstein collaborates with scholars based in United States, Chile and Switzerland. Liza M. Rubenstein's co-authors include Kiara R. Timpano, Dennis L. Murphy, Lauren B. Alloy, Pablo R. Moya, Jens R. Wendland, Rachel D. Freed, Meredith A. Fox, Jessica L. Hamilton, Lyn Y. Abramson and Jonathan P. Stange and has published in prestigious journals such as Philosophical Transactions of the Royal Society B Biological Sciences, Movement Disorders and Behavior Therapy.
